Transaction 3755af446e59fd5f18e4a7538c68a51747601199e14a50de23ccf6354bf3ca04

1 Input
2 Outputs
  • 3755af446e59fd5f18e4a7538c68a51747601199e14a50de23ccf6354bf3ca04:0
  • value  159970
    address  37V5YoziScwWb3vcBAKJLuoeR3KnbnXkuX
  • 3755af446e59fd5f18e4a7538c68a51747601199e14a50de23ccf6354bf3ca04:1
  • value  1146051
    address  3MSGtRvZokoXVUBfZ7e43hsygjEVRqK7mF